Title
Polarization dependent frequency shift induced BER penalty in DPSK demodulators

Abstract
We experimentally analyzed the induced penalty due to polarization dependent frequency shift (PDf) for 10 GHz and 40 GHz DPSK demodulators, revealing a strong correlation with the PDf ratio and filtering effect of the delay interferometer.
